Pippa Middleton will not be able to promote her forthcoming book because it could "embarrass" her sister.

Duchess Catherine's younger sibling is soon to release her party planning bible 'Celebrate', but publishers are concerned they are in a "tricky situation" because of her close ties to the British royal family.

A source said: "She would normally be expected to appear on every chat show under the sun.

"I know she won't do anything that she hasn't run by the duchess' advisers, but it is still a very tricky situation."

Despite being offered the chance to have the tome ghost-written, Pippa - who rose to fame as her sister's maid of honour at her April 2011 wedding to Prince William - has insisted on writing it herself.

The source added to the Mail on Sunday newspaper: "She was offered a whole host of ghost writers but said no to them all and is very proud that it is all her own work.

"I just don't think she appreciated how much work it would take and may need some help from her editors."
